TI - Experimental Investigation on Thermal Diffusion in Ternary Hydrocarbon Mixtures T2 - Fluid Dynamics \& Materials Processing PY - 2017 VL - 13 IS - 4 SN - 1555-2578 AB - The main goal of this study was to investigate the thermal diffusion in ternary hydrocarbon mixtures composed of 1, 2, 3, 4 Tetrahydronaphtalene (THN)-Isobutylbenzene (IBB)-Dodecane (C12) with mass fractions of 80/10/10, 70/10/20, and 60/10/30 at mean temperature of 25 °C. Optical interferometry technique with Mach-Zehnder arrangement was used to conduct the experiments. The mixture was placed in a convectionless cell which was heated from above. The results for the mixture with mass fraction of 80/10/10 were in a good agreement with the corresponding benchmark values. Finally, the Soret coefficient for the other two mixtures have been proposed. KW - Thermal diffusion KW - interferometry KW - Mach-Zehnder DO - 10.3970/fdmp.2017.013.213
